And this is why...

Apple Mac Mini Installed in Trunk, Alpine 4 Channel Amp powering the Polk Momo speakers. 7" Touchscreen display. The power supply sleeps the computer 6 seconds after shutting the key off. Upon ignition, the computer wakes up and you are viewing the desktop in 5 seconds.

The owner wrote his own software for the computer for easy acess to media stored on it. He can also connect to the internet at 4mb/s via the bluetooth connection on his broadband cell phone, and can essentially download any song he wants to hear while crusing down the road. Some of you are going to ask "What, no radio?" Well, the answer is no, but you can always go to the radio stations website and stream it through the mac mini, lol

Quote:
Originally Posted by blackparis View Post
Is there a keyboard with that thing?

How much wattage does that powersupply draw while the mac is sleeping?

I've been wanting to do a car-puter for a long time now.... But I would much rather spend the $ on performance parts...

EDIT: Also what cell phone does he have? Do all bluetooth phones have this internet capabilty?
You can use a bluetooth keyboard, but all of the functions needed for daily use are operated via the touch screen.

It draws as much as leaving your cell phone plugged into the charger. After 14 days of the car sitting without being started, it automatically shuts the computer down and turns the power supply off.

It's a verizon broadband phone, I don't know what kind... it looks like a blackberry type of phone...
